When I panic (and I often do when I can't find something that I know has to be there) I resort to using a third party search tool called "Everything" from here http://www.voidtools.com/downloads/
Seems to continue to work fine in Windows 10.
You might want to give it a try and just simply search for *.doc or *.docx
See if that might show where they are hiding.
